REDEEMER 3, MOHAWK 0

The Mohawk men's volleyball team played giant killer at the Fennell Gymnasium ON Saturday (Feb. 9) when they knocked off the high-flying Redeemer Royals in a real barn-burner, 25-19, 25-18, 24-26, 19-25, 17-15.

Mo Sulaiman had another big night for the Mountaineers with 19 kills and four struff blocks. Marcin Jedrzejewski had 14 kills and one block, while his brother Bart had 24 digs.

David Klomps had 15 kills, two service aces and two blocks to pace Redeemer, which entered the match tied for first place with Niagara, but saw their record fall to 13-4. Mohawk upped its mark to 9-8.

The Mohawk women were swept by Redeemer, 25-13, 25-23, 27-25.

Redeemer's Curtiss Straatsma had a monster game, leading all players with 18 kills, five stuff blocks and 10 digs. April Passchier contributed seven kills and five service aces. Mohawk was led by Chantal Baker with eight kills and eight digs.

"Tonight we had our best match of the second half," said Mountaineers head coach Andrew Nicholson. "The girls worked hard on every point in sets two and three and with any luck we could have won both. We felt very good about ourselves tonight even though we lost."

Mohawk's record dropped to 6-11, whilke Redeemer improved to 8-9.
